Subminiature Switch SB5
EBE
1.0 Construction
1.1 Number of banks max.
1 bank
1.2 Switching combinations per bank Design J, detent angle 90°
1x2; 2x2
with contactless central position at 45°
Design G, detent angle 45°
1x3
1.3 Contacts for SMT
J-hook=version A; Gullwing = version B
Contacts for printed circuits
Soldering pins = version C
1.4 Mounting
Soldering
2.0 Electrical Data
2.1 Switching power max.
0,5W
2.2 Switching voltage max.
16V-
2.3 Switching current max.
100 mA
2.4 Test voltage at 50 Hz
500 V
2.5 Operating life without power
> 200 cycles
2.6 Contact resistance initial value
< 100 mfl
2.7 Insulation resistance
1x108 Q
3.0 Mechanical Data
3.1 Switching mode
Nonshorting
3.2 Stops
Fixed
3.3 Operating torque
2,5 Ncm
3.4 Shock strength
50g
3.5 Dust protection
Bank sealed
3.6 Cleaning*
Suitable for complete cleaning in ultrasonic bath
*With known agents, such as Freon, Arclone usw.
4.0 Other Data
4.1 Contact material
Ag
4.2 Insulating material
Diallylphthalate, DAP; Code DI
4.3 Ambient temperature
-40 to +70C
4.4 Soldering time and temperature max.
4s at 260°C,wave soldering 10s at 180C, Infrared-reflow-soldering Peak temperature 240C
Ordering Codes
Designation of type SB5
1. Number of circuits per bank 1 or 2
2. Number of switching positions 2 or3
3. Contacts A =J-hook, B =Gullwing, C = Soldering pins, standard
Subminiature switch with extremely small dimensions.
• Developed for SMT soldering processes: wave- and infrared-reflow-soldering.
• Suitable for automatically insertion with most of the„Pickand Place"-auto-mation machines.
• For sufficiently large number of units also available in embossed tapes on request.
